About the Role
A 12–14-week AI research internship at XTY Labs in New York, focused on machine learning, optimization, generative AI, foundation models, distributed training, and quantitative trading applications.
Requirements
- Pursuing an advanced degree, ideally a Ph.D., in computer science, electrical engineering, mathematics, or a related quantitative field, with at least one year remaining before graduation.
- Proven ability to conduct original research, including publications in leading machine learning and AI venues.
- Strong practical understanding of deep learning architectures, particularly transformers.
- Knowledge of data science, optimization, and statistics.
- Strong programming skills; Python is acceptable.
- Expertise with foundation models, large language models, and multimodal frameworks is desirable.
- Experience managing and analyzing large, unstructured, noisy datasets is desirable.
- Hands-on time series forecasting knowledge is desirable.
- No prior finance experience is required.
Responsibilities
- Conduct original machine learning research and investigate novel methods.
- Apply deep learning, natural language processing, time series analysis, control, optimization, and reinforcement learning.
- Build and refine robust models, agents, and software prototypes.
- Communicate research progress and findings verbally and in writing.
- Collaborate with quantitative researchers and foster teamwork.
Benefits
- Sign-on bonus for accommodation costs
- Benefits similar to those provided to US permanent employees
- Mentorship from a full-time researcher and the Research Director
- Consideration for full-time research roles in New York or London
Hiring Process
Four stages: introductory conversation with recruitment; practical take-home AI modeling exercise; discussion with the Research Director; and a final one-hour interview with an XTX Quantitative Researcher or XTY full-time Researcher.
